The Federal Labor Relations Authority's decision upholding Customs' implementation of the RNIAP and termination of local bargaining obligations was upheld on appeal. The court found the FLRA's determination that the RNIAP effectively revoked the obligation to bargain locally over rotation and days off was not arbitrary or capricious.
